Methylcellulose, A4M Food Grade

Product Description
Product | Methylcellulose, A4M Food Grade |
CAS | 9004-67-5 |
Synonym | MC, Cellulose, methyl ether, Cellulose, methyl ether |
Typical Product Specifications
Apparent Viscosity, cp | 3500-5600 |
Loss on Drying | 5.0max |
Heavy Metals | 10 max |
pH @ 25 ยฐC | 5.5-8.0 |
Methoxyl Content | 28.0-32.0 |
Mold | 100/gram max |
Residue on Ignition | 1.5 max |
Arsenic PPM | 3.0 max |
Total Bacteria | 1000/gram max |
Particle Size | 95% min through 40 mesh |
Appearance | White powder |
Organic Volatile Impurities | Meets the requrements |
Insolubility | in alcohol, ether, chloroform, warm water |
Odor | grayish-wh. fibrous powd., odorless, tasteless |
Molecular weight | 86,000-115,000 |
Solubility | cold water, glacial acetic acid, some org. solvs. |
Notes | The material meets all requirements for the Food Grade Methylcellulose and Kosher certified. Use: BINDING, EMULSION STABILISING, STABILISING, VISCOSITY CONTROLLING |
Class | Excipients - Food Colors - Binders and Tableting Aids |
